void SystemBaseFrameBuffer::GetCenteredPos(int in_w, int in_h, int &winx, int &winy, int &winw, int &winh, int &scrwidth, int &scrheight) | ||
{ | ||
DEVMODE displaysettings; | ||
RECT rect; | ||
int cx, cy; | ||
|
||
memset(&displaysettings, 0, sizeof(displaysettings)); | ||
displaysettings.dmSize = sizeof(displaysettings); | ||
EnumDisplaySettings(NULL, ENUM_CURRENT_SETTINGS, &displaysettings); | ||
scrwidth = (int)displaysettings.dmPelsWidth; | ||
scrheight = (int)displaysettings.dmPelsHeight; | ||
GetWindowRect(Window, &rect); | ||
cx = scrwidth / 2; | ||
cy = scrheight / 2; | ||
if (in_w > 0) winw = in_w; | ||
else winw = rect.right - rect.left; | ||
if (in_h > 0) winh = in_h; | ||
else winh = rect.bottom - rect.top; | ||
winx = cx - winw / 2; | ||
winy = cy - winh / 2; | ||
} | ||
|
||
//========================================================================== | ||
// | ||
// | ||
// | ||
//========================================================================== | ||
|
||
void SystemBaseFrameBuffer::KeepWindowOnScreen(int &winx, int &winy, int winw, int winh, int scrwidth, int scrheight) | ||
{ | ||
// If the window is too large to fit entirely on the screen, at least | ||
// keep its upperleft corner visible. | ||
if (winx + winw > scrwidth) | ||
{ | ||
winx = scrwidth - winw; | ||
} | ||
if (winx < 0) | ||
{ | ||
winx = 0; | ||
} | ||
if (winy + winh > scrheight) | ||
{ | ||
winy = scrheight - winh; | ||
} | ||
if (winy < 0) | ||
{ | ||
winy = 0; | ||
} | ||
} | ||
